Merrion Square Lights Up This Christmas

Minister for Tourism and Sport Michael Ring switched on the Christmas lights display at Merrion Square yesterday which is being sponsored by ESB.

This is an initiative of the Merrion Square Innovation Network to promote the square as a tourist attraction for locals and international people. Fáilte Ireland and some associates came up with the idea.

37 businesses and stakeholders gathered together last year to organize fun events to promote the area. These events include Christmas on the Square, which was held again last weekend.

"This is a special part of Dublin with an important Georgian heritage, which has too often been overlooked by tourists and even by Dubliners," said the Minister.

"Thanks to an ongoing campaign and events like this one today we are hoping to change that. Since the initiative was launched last year, many of the Georgian buildings in the square have opened their doors to the public for the first time. This promises to be a magical Christmas in Dublin, and Merrion Square will be back in the spotlight for the New Year's Eve Ultimate Gathering to finish off the year."
